    I bought an 01 Camaro Z28 in September of 01. It was a leftover and I got a great deal. I was always a Ford guy so that was a huge leap of faith for me.

    I went to a Camaro Show in August of 2002 and I got a coupon for an additional $1000 off on a new Camaro. I had financed my 01 and the payments were $420 a month for 60 months. In late September I went to a local dealer and bought the 13th Vin number from the last Camaro made. Pewter silver. With the coupon my payments went from $420 per month to $425 per month for 48 months. Basically for $240 I moved up 1 model year and dropped 10,000 miles off my car. No money down.

    That was one of the best cars I've ever owned. It ran 13.6 stock and with just a catback, lid and the FRAM mod ran 13.0 at 109.

    My 02 now has been great too. The LSX is the modern day Hemi 426. These cars are beyond belief.
